Keysville, Virginia: Connecting the Community with High-Speed Internet

Nestled in the heart of Charlotte County, Virginia, the charming town of Keysville offers a blend of small-town charm and modern amenities. As the home of one of the two branches of Southside Virginia Community College, Keysville is a hub of education and opportunity, catering to both local residents and students from the surrounding region.

The town's geography is defined by its strategic location, with U.S. Routes 15 and 360 forming its eastern border and Virginia State Route 40 passing through the center. This convenient transportation network connects Keysville to nearby cities like Farmville and Burkeville, making it an attractive destination for businesses and families alike.

One of the key priorities for Keysville's revitalization efforts has been the introduction of high-speed internet access. Through the Tobacco Indemnification fund, an optical fiber link was established between Keysville and Farmville, laying the foundation for improved connectivity in the region. This initiative aims to support the development of the Southside Industrial Park, attracting mid-sized businesses that require reliable and fast internet services.

When it comes to internet options, Keysville residents have a variety of providers to choose from. CenturyLink and Verizon Virginia LLC offer DSL services, with maximum download speeds of 60 Mbps and 15 Mbps, respectively. For those seeking faster connections, Kinex Telecom provides fiber-optic internet with blazing-fast speeds of up to 75 Mbps download and 10 Mbps upload.

Satellite internet options are also available in Keysville, with HughesNet and Viasat Inc. offering download speeds up to 25 Mbps and 35 Mbps, respectively. These satellite-based services can be particularly useful for residents in more remote areas of the town.

For those who prefer a wireless solution, Keysville is served by several terrestrial fixed wireless providers, including B2X Online, T-Mobile, and United States Cellular Corporation. These options can deliver download speeds ranging from 2 Mbps to 150 Mbps, catering to a variety of needs and budgets.
